We all have bad habits that we would like to break. Whether it's procrastination, overeating, smoking, or excessive social media use, bad habits can negatively impact our lives and prevent us from achieving our goals. Breaking a bad habit is not an easy task, but with the right strategies and mindset, it is definitely possible. In this article, we will discuss some effective ways to break bad habits.

Identify the habit and its triggers

The first step in breaking a bad habit is to identify it and understand its triggers. Ask yourself, what is the habit that you want to break? When do you usually engage in this habit? What triggers it? Understanding the habit and its triggers can help you prepare for the times when you are most likely to engage in the habit.

Replace the bad habit with a good one

Breaking a bad habit is not just about stopping the behavior, but also about replacing it with a good one. For example, if your bad habit is overeating, you can replace it with healthy snacking or drinking water instead. If your bad habit is smoking, you can replace it with meditation or exercise. The idea is to find a positive behavior that can replace the negative one and make it a part of your routine.

Create a plan and stick to it

Breaking a bad habit requires commitment and consistency. Create a plan that outlines the steps you will take to break the habit, and stick to it. The plan should include specific goals, such as reducing the frequency of the habit, and timelines for achieving those goals. Make sure to track your progress and celebrate your successes along the way.

Get support

Breaking a bad habit can be challenging, but having a support system can make it easier. Tell your friends and family about your goal and ask for their support. You can also join a support group or find an accountability partner who is also trying to break a bad habit. Having someone to talk to and share your progress with can help you stay motivated and focused.

Change your environment

Your environment can play a big role in shaping your behavior. To break a bad habit, you may need to change your environment or avoid situations that trigger the habit. For example, if you have a habit of watching TV late at night, you can remove the TV from your bedroom or set a curfew for yourself. If your bad habit is overeating, you can remove unhealthy snacks from your home and stock up on healthy alternatives.

Practice mindfulness

Mindfulness can help you become more aware of your thoughts and emotions, which can help you break a bad habit. When you feel the urge to engage in the habit, take a moment to pause and observe your thoughts and emotions. Ask yourself why you want to engage in the habit and whether it aligns with your goals and values. Practicing mindfulness can help you develop a sense of self-awareness and control over your behavior.

Breaking a bad habit is not easy, but it is possible with the right mindset and strategies. By identifying the habit and its triggers, replacing the bad habit with a good one, creating a plan and sticking to it, getting support, changing your environment, and practicing mindfulness, you can successfully break a bad habit and improve your overall well-being. Remember to be patient with yourself and celebrate your successes along the way.
